Purple bellflowerThis is a relatively common variety, distributed in Northeast China, North China, Northwest China, Southwest China, Shaanxi Province, Gansu Province, Henan Province, Hubei Province, Sichuan Province and other provinces and regions. The whole plant can be used as medicine. The flowers are terminal and drooping. The corolla is white with purple spots. Rarely, it is lavender and tubular and bell-shaped. CampanulaNative to the moist woodlands of North America, it is a tall plant with a blue to white color that sways in the wind and grows in clumps among mountain rocks. CampanulaThis biennial herb is an edible bellflower whose roots and leaves can be made into salads and whose flowers are white or purple. Although edible, this variety is rarely grown in China.
